## Summary

EPAM is a deep-value IT services franchise trading at 6.05x forward EPS with $1.04B cash and near-zero net debt after a -58% YTD collapse, but the entire thesis pivots on the August 6th earnings print (~21 days away) reversing Q1's 27.7% gross margin compression and -$36M operating cash flow. Technicals show a bottoming pattern holding $80 support with a modest bounce off $73 lows, while the AI forecast band projects $105-113 into month-end — a move that requires margin proof, not just multiple expansion. Given the binary catalyst risk and repeated overshoot of prior bull targets, we favor a small pre-earnings starter position with the majority of capital reserved for post-print confirmation.

## News context

The news flow is uniformly negative on sell-side sentiment: Deutsche Bank cut its target to $85 (from $110), Wells Fargo trimmed to $125 (from $151) but stayed Overweight, TD Cowen cut to $131 (from $170) but maintained Buy. The July 10 tape saw a -3.9% intraday reaction to the Deutsche cut. The signal here is that even the bulls are marking down price targets meaningfully while retaining buy ratings — this is classic capitulation-in-progress on the sell-side, which often coincides with (but does not guarantee) a bottom. The Zacks value-oriented coverage ("Are Investors Undervaluing EPAM?") and StockStory's inclusion of EPAM in an "oversold, ready to bounce" screen indicate the deep-value narrative has fully permeated the coverage universe. Note the L1 signal: institutional ownership actually ticked up from 117% to 120.7% (over 100% because of short covering mechanics and float dynamics — short float is 22.4%, an enormous crowd short), meaning institutions have been accumulating even as the stock has drifted lower. That short interest is the single most interesting technical feature — any positive earnings surprise on August 6 could catalyze a squeeze of material size.
